What do you hope to do when you graduate?
During my final year I wrote to a range of British institutions including Westminster Abbey, eight months later I found himself standing before representatives of one of the UK’s most historic landmarks, presenting the chair to the Abbey.
I would like to do a masters in furniture design or furniture business management in Milan next or set up on my own. But we will see, either way I’ll be happy just designing stuff.
What was your favourite thing about your course?
The degree has given me lots of practical skills such as CAD, Model making, presenting etc and changed my way I approach designing and presenting something. It has set me up to do my job.

Would you recommend UWTSD and why?
Yes! The lecturing staff are friendly, patient and knowledgeable. They allow you the freedom to be creative, make mistakes and guide you through the course. The class sizes though small works in its favour as you get a lot of 1 on 1 time with the staff. All 3 years share the studio allowing you to make friends over the three years.
